S v THE NEW ZEALAND TEACHERS COUNCIL [2014] NZHC 2881
- Citation
- [2014] NZHC 2881
- Court
- High Court
The Council's categorical policy of deferring renewal decisions while complaints were before the CAC, without informing the applicant in time to preserve appeal or extension rights, breached natural justice and unlawfully failed to exercise the statutory decision; declaratory relief is warranted though mandatory relief was refused given changed circumstances and delay.
